Other Royal Society activityOccasional correspondent (1683);
Had a paper on polyps published in the 'Philosophical Transactions' (1684)
RelationshipsParents: James Gould
OtherInfoNot much is known about Gould's personal life or his medical practice after qualifying. He was not particularly active in the Society after his election and was never in the accounts. His correspondence related to observations on sulphurica acid.
